Longtime West Springfield resident, Carolyn (Fogg) Calabrese, 85, died peacefully on Saturday, June 4, 2022, surrounded by her loving family. Born in Springfield to the late Walter and Barbara (Chapin) Fogg, she was a graduate of Agawam High School, Class of 1955 Valedictorian. Carolyn’s greatest joy was her family. She loved being at home baking pies for her boys when she was a young homemaker and curling up with a good book in the screenhouse. She loved flowers, sewing, crochet, needlepoint, could cook the most amazing turkey dinner and made Christmas Eve magical. Carolyn was predeceased by her beloved granddaughter Lisa Calabrese and her loving husband Louis J. Calabrese, Sr. She will be sadly missed by her devoted children; Joseph Calabrese and his wife Ann, Louis Calabrese, Jr. and his wife Sandy, all of West Springfield and daughter Amy Mendrala and her husband Michael of Feeding Hills, brothers; Walter Fogg and his wife Beverly and James Fogg and his wife Jerry, sister in law Judy Calabrese, five loving grandchildren; Kristen Buoniconti (Bill), Dr. Bethany Calabrese (Joseph Judge), Chelsea Pighetti (Dave) and Hayden and Harrison Mendrala and 4 cherished great grandchildren; Enzo and Marco Buoniconti and Vincent and Gio Pighetti. In recent years, Carolyn had been missing her sweetheart of 65 years, Lou.
